Features:
  • Dimensions: 7.1" overall length with a blade length of 3.1" and a weight of 3.5 ounces
  • Blade is made of 7Cr17MoV Black Oxide High Carbon Stainless Steel with a black, aluminum handle
  • Pocket clip, finger flipper and ambidextrous thumb knobs making it ideal for everyday carry
